Foxtail Lily Eremurus spectabilis
Prices start at : 8.95 USD / 1 packet

* The young shoots are eaten cooked. Considered to be a delicacy in Siberia, the flavour is intermediate between purslane and spinach. * Eremurus spectabilis is a PERENNIAL growing to 1 m (3ft 3in) by 0.6 m (2ft).

Edelweiss LEONTOPODIUM alpinum
Prices start at : 5.95 USD / 1 packet

The name comes from German edel (meaning noble ) and weiss (meaning white ). The scientific name, Leontopodium , means " lion's paw" and is derived from the Greek words leon (lion) and podion (diminutive of pous , foot).
